How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Kingston?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Kingston Studio Apartments | $2,307 | $1,395 | $2,980 |
| Kingston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,225 | $1,273 | $3,820 |
| Kingston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,817 | $897 | $5,940 |
| Kingston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,582 | $1,033 | $4,655 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Kingston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Kingston?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Kingston with Swimming Pool is at Quail Ridge Apartments listed at $1,557.
How much is the average rent for Kingston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Kingston with Swimming Pool is $2,746.
What is the largest Kingston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Kingston is a 1,620 square feet unit starting from $2,399 at Lofts at Princeton.
What is the average size for Kingston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Kingston is currently at 680 sq ft.
